Can You Bring Food in Your Carry-On Bag on Air Canada Flights?

Yes, you can bring food in your carry-on on Air Canada. Ensure items are well-packaged and adhere to security regulations, including liquid and gel restrictions. Check local customs rules for international flights to avoid issues upon arrival.

FAQs & Answers

  1. Are there any restrictions on liquids and gels in carry-on food on Air Canada flights? Yes, liquids and gels in your carry-on, including food items like sauces and yogurt, must comply with TSA liquid restrictions, typically 100ml per container in a clear bag.
  2. Can I bring fresh fruits and snacks in my carry-on on Air Canada? Yes, you can bring fresh fruits and snacks in your carry-on, but ensure they are well-packaged and check customs regulations if traveling internationally.
  3. Do customs rules affect bringing food in carry-on bags on international Air Canada flights? Yes, when flying internationally, local customs rules may restrict certain food items. It's important to check destination-specific regulations to avoid confiscation.
